Transaction

ef8b39dd366751dfdff6128ad6a32264af6db883bff0b0a57aebf427d356d8cc
289,912 confirmations
Timestamp
1598092978
Block644,830
Fee1,356 sats
Fee rate7.10 sats/vB
view on mempool.space

Inputs & Outputs